Flood Warning Issued Saturday Night for Homeview, Sterling Downs Neighborhoods
A water pipe that burst combined with the rain prompted the flood warning.
UPDATE 10:43 a.m., Sunday: The flood warning is over and there were no reports of flooding due to the burst water pipe.
UPDATE 6:45 p.m., Saturday: The has issued a flood warning for the Homeview and Sterling Downs neighborhoods tonight after a water pipe burst in the area.
The pipe burst sometime this afternoon and could affect both water lines and sewer lines, police said. The rainy weather is also a factor in the flood warning.

The South Bayside System Authority is reportedly repairing the line.
Sandbags are available for residents at three locations; the Police Department, where police are filling the bags for residents; and at Barrett Community Center and the Belmont Corporation Yard at 110 Sem Lane, where residents must fill the sandbags themselves.
